How to Export Expense Reports

1/13/2026
8-10 minutes
beginner
Our Expense Reports feature helps you to generate and export your expense data. You can export this data in multiple formats. Here we have put together a step-by-step method for exporting your data. After reading, you will be able to: Export data in PDF for printing purposes In Excel format for the analysis of your data Some specialized formats for your accounting software. So stay with us and explore in detail.

Prerequisites

  • You should have uploaded expenses in the Expenses section
  • You should have access to the Reports page
  • You must understand your workspace role and permissions

Outcome

  • Generate reports for a selected date range and category
  • Download, email, or share reports with your accountant

Steps

1

Navigate to Reports

Start by navigating to the report page. For this, go to your dashboard and click on reports. You will find this in the main navigation section. When the report page opens, you will see four tabs. These will include: Expense Reports Bank Statement Reports Income Reports Tax & Compliance.

2

Click New Report

Now you will find a green button for new reports on the top right corner of this page. You can click on this to start creating a new report. After clicking on this button, a new report generation panel will appear. It will show all available options for customisation of your export.

3

Select Your Date Range

From this new panel, you can select the date range for which you need to export your expenses. There are two ways for this: the first one is Quick Select financial quarters (Q1-Q4). Secondly, you can enter a custom date range manually. If you don't select either, all existing expense records will be included.

4

Filter by Category (Optional)

Another incredible feature that you can find here is that you can apply a filter. You can select your expense type from the category section, either personal or business. When you select the specific date range and category on those expenses in that duration and category will export.

5

Choose Export Format

After selecting the date and category, you can also select your desired export format. There are a number of formats available, each for a different purpose. Here are the available formats: ZIP for backup CSV for analysis PDF for printing Excel for advanced analysis Accounting software formats (Xero, QuickBooks, MYOB) for direct import.

6

Generate and Download

Finally, click the export button for your chosen format. The system will automatically generate your report. Once the report is ready the system will notify you. You can then download it, email it, or delete it from the Generated Reports section.

Troubleshooting

Please select the date range error

If you see an error for the date range, it means you need to check your date entry, either a financial quarter (Q1-Q4) OR a custom date range. Make sure both fields have valid dates, and the start date must be before the end date.

Please select category error.

To resolve the category error, make sure you select the category type in the filter. For this, you must select both a category type (Personal or Business) and a main category. Remember to uncheck the category box in the filter in case you don't want to choose between categories and export both personal and business expenses.

Please select the type of error

You need to select either 'Personal' or 'Business' from the Category Type dropdown. The Main Category dropdown will then populate with available options.

No expenses available

If you see "no expense available", it means you haven't uploaded any expenses yet. In order to see expenses you must upload receipts. So, go to the Expenses section to upload receipts. Once expenses are uploaded, you can return to Reports to generate exports.

Report generation takes too long

If your reports are taking too long, it means you have selected large date ranges with many expenses. That's why it takes longer to process. To resolve this issue, try narrowing your date range or filtering by category to reduce data volume. If the problem still persists please make sure you have a reliable internet connection.

File won't download

Check your browser's download settings. Try a different browser. Ensure pop-ups aren't blocked. Try the Email option instead of sending the report to yourself.

Can't delete the report

If you are not able to delete the report, you may not have permission to delete reports. Only workspace owners and admins can delete reports. You have to contact your workspace owner if you need a report deleted.

Report not appearing in the list.

If you don't see your report in the list, be patient; the report may be generating. Otherwise please: Refresh the page so you can find the required report. Make sure that you're viewing the correct workspace. Verify you have permission to view reports.
